    About Le Club Restaurant

    Le Club Restaurant in Missillac is presented as a relaxed dining room led by Chef Filipe Silvestre. The verified cuisine description is an “expression of the terroir,” with brasserie-style classics alongside original creations. The menu is described as different every day, so the best way to approach a visit is to expect a changing brasserie format rather than a fixed signature-dish list.

    In summer, twice a week and weather permitting, Le Club Restaurant also offers meats barbecued on the grill or cooked à la plancha. Because that cooking is seasonal and conditional, guests should confirm directly before planning a meal around it. The verified dress code is smart casual, matching the restaurant’s relaxed atmosphere without suggesting a formal fine-dining format.

    Restaurant context

    Le Club Restaurant sits at the accessible end of Domaine de la Bretesche's three-venue dining ladder, below the main estate restaurant (French Country) and Le Montaigu (Modern Cuisine). If you're staying on the estate and want a solid meal without the ceremony, Le Club delivers daily-changing brasserie fare and, weather permitting, outdoor grill service twice weekly in summer. It's the right pick for golfers, families, or anyone prioritizing flexibility over a set tasting menu. Booking is easier here than at Le Montaigu, the relaxed atmosphere means you can drop in after a round without changing clothes.

    Outside the estate, Missillac's dining scene is thin, so your real alternatives cluster in Nantes (45 minutes) or La Baule (30 minutes). 14 Avenue in La Baule offers a similar terroir-focused brasserie format but with easier walk-in availability and no reliance on seasonal grill nights. If you're visiting Missillac specifically for Domaine de la Bretesche, treat Le Club as the estate's everyday option and reserve Le Montaigu for the special-occasion dinner; splitting your stay between the two gives you range without leaving the property.
